France’s National Assembly and Senate has adopted a finance bill that includes a substantial increase in the airline ticket “solidarity tax” (TSBA), effective March 1, 2025.

Economy-class ticket taxes will rise from €2.63 to €7.40, while business-class tickets will face a tax increase to €30, with long-haul flights incurring taxes up to €120.

Air France forecasts a €100m financial impact from this tax hike, which poses significant challenges for the airline’s recovery and investments in decarbonisation.

Industry groups, including the European Business Aviation Association and the Fédération Nationale de l’Aviation et de ses Métiers, have opposed the tax increases, saying they wil result in job losses and reduced competitiveness for French aviation amidst ongoing economic recovery efforts.
